Chanel and Shinsegae Duty Free collaborate to launch holiday themed megapodium

by Gian Japsay

-

November 20, 2023

Seoul, South Korea – Global designer brand Chanel and Shinsegae Duty Free has recently collaborated to launch ’CHANEL WONDERLAND’, a cooperative endeavour  in the form of a holiday themed megapodium, which took place at Terminal 2 of the Incheon International Airport on November 16, 2023. 

With the intention of captivating tourists throughout the holiday season, CHANEL WONDERLAND was designed as a giant platform. At seven metres high and over one hundred and thirty square metres in size, this platform is massive and ready to improve the duty-free experience. The creation’s central theme, “the magic of a special holiday with Chanel,” gives the immersive experience it provides life. 

When visitors enter CHANEL WONDERLAND, they are met by a holiday ambiance as they discover a sequence of Chanel gift boxes hidden within another, all framed by a Christmas tree made of Chanel perfume sculptures and gift boxes.

Seemingly inspired by fairy tales, the megapodium features a design with white and black tones that reflect Chanel’s elegance. The addition of vivid gold elements to the setting further enhances its overall aesthetic appeal.

Visitors to “CHANEL WONDERLAND” have the opportunity to look into Chanel’s newest holiday season offerings, which include exclusive limited-edition items only available within the confines of CHANEL WONDERLAND, as well as sample and purchase various Chanel perfume products. Visitors can also take pictures in the zone backdrop. 

Speaking about the launch, Chung Hee Eun, general manager of cosmetics & perfume of Shinsegae Duty Free, said, “Shinsegae Duty Free is proud to present Chanel House and this extraordinary mega beauty destination at Incheon Airport, just in time for the Christmas and year-end holiday season. We aim to provide both domestic and international travellers with a special and memorable moment when they visit CHANEL WONDERLAND.”
